Fun story: I was part of the licensing team that got Hip To Be Square in that movie. Lewis did not want to the license the song, especially in the context of that scene. But the music supervisor was persistent, so as a goof Hooeylewis quoted an absurd fee, like 8x what he'd normally go for. Well, the filmmakers accepted. When a recoding is licensed, we as the label don't necessarily know (or get paid) until the movie is actually released and the song in included in the final cut. So when the movie came out and, well.... you know...... that scene plays out, Hooeylewis was as angry as a Hooeylewis can get.
I mean, Hooeylewis cashed the checks and all, but he sort of lost his mind over this. He couldn't do anything about the movie, but he huffed and puffed enough that the soundtrack album was pulled from distribution and something like 100,000 physical copies were destroyed. The public story is that they failed to secure publishing rights to include the song on the soundtrack, but I know that our quote for the in-context use for the master recording in the film also included a quote for inclusion on the soundtrack album. So I find the claims that publishing wasn't secured to be vague and unconvincing.
For 20+ years Lewis has denied that he threw such a fit, but I was on the other end of the emails and phone calls. He absolutely threw his s**t out of his cage.
